About 4-[2-[4-(1,1-difluoroethyl)phenyl]pyrrolidin-1-yl]-5-fluoro-6-[2-[3-(1,2,4-triazol-1-ylmethyl)phenyl]ethyl]pyrimidine

4-[2-[4-(1,1-difluoroethyl)phenyl]pyrrolidin-1-yl]-5-fluoro-6-[2-[3-(1,2,4-triazol-1-ylmethyl)phenyl]ethyl]pyrimidine (PubChem CID 157277590) has the molecular formula C27H27F3N6 and a molecular weight of 492.55 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-[2-[4-(1,1-difluoroethyl)phenyl]pyrrolidin-1-yl]-5-fluoro-6-[2-[3-(1,2,4-triazol-1-ylmethyl)phenyl]ethyl]pyrimidine.
